A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the supply of 255,000 containerized longleaf pine seedlings that must comply with Florida forestry standards, encompassing all aspects of production from lifting and packaging to cold-chain storage prior to delivery. The seedlings are required to be handled and maintained under strict environmental controls to ensure viability and adherence to state-specific horticultural and ecological guidelines appropriate for reforestation and conservation efforts. The work is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 111421, indicating it falls within the nursery and tree production sector. The opportunity was posted on July 17, 2026, with a response deadline of August 3, 2026, at 2:00 PM, and is being procured by the Suwannee River Water Management District in Florida. The place of performance and exact delivery location are not specified in the provided details, but the seedlings will be delivered to support projects under the jurisdiction of the Florida agency. All parties must ensure compliance with applicable regulatory standards and maintain the integrity of the cold chain from processing through final delivery. The solicitation is accessible through the Florida marketplace portal for eligible vendors.
